Job Overview

Provides user support and training in all aspects of clinical information systems, including planning, organizing, communicating and coordinating all activities. Activities include the maintenance and implementation of all clinical information systems and their interfaces to other systems and devices in the hospital. To act as a liaison between clinical, technical, administrative and home office staff in regards to the clinical information system.

 

This position is full-time, exempt and benefits eligible. The pay range for this position is $89,148 - $133,744/year. Compensation is based on years of experience and departmental equity. 

Responsibilities

 

  • Plans, organizes, communicates and coordinates all activities related to clinical information systems. 
  • Provides user support, maintenance and on-going training for the clinical information system and related interfaces and devices. 
  • Maintains an understanding of the workflow, process, policies and procedures that impact the hospital and are related to the clinical information system. 
  • Maintains compliance with all expectations regarding departmental and hospital policies.

Note: This is not an all-inclusive list of this job’s responsibilities. The incumbent may be required to perform other related duties and participate in special projects as assigned.

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or's Degree in related Health Care Field.
  • Three years experience in Information systems, specific to healthcare.
  • Three years Project management and database experience in a healthcare setting.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ite
